Bhagavatī (Devanagari: भगवती, IAST: Bhagavatī), is a Hindu epithet of Sanskrit origin, used as an honorific title for female deities in Hinduism. It is primarily used to address one of the Tridevi: Saraswati, Lakshmi, and Parvati.

The male equivalent of Bhagavatī is Bhagavān. The term is an equivalent of Devi and Ishvari.
